Section 6(2)
POCA 2002
Proceeds of Crime Act 2002 · United Kingdom
The first condition is that a defendant falls within any of the following paragraphs— he is convicted of an offence or offences in proceedings before the Crown Court; he is committed to the Crown Court for sentence in respect of an offence or offences under section 3, 4 or 6 section 3, 3A, 3B, 3C, 4, 4A or 6 of the Sentencing Act any provision of sections 14 to 20 of the Sentencing Code; he is committed to the Crown Court in respect of an offence or offences under section 70 below (committal with a view to a confiscation order being considered).
